History and Design

The Air Jordan 4 was designed by Tinker Hatfield and was the first Air Jordan model to feature visible Air cushioning in the heel. The "White Cement" colorway, with its white leather upper, black accents, cement grey detailing, and signature red Jumpman logo, remains one of the most coveted versions of the AJ4.
